Output 23b0d58c45ee88d543b4e0f5e8148eb27b5961a4c3a1bdb3f1db90ec06eee8bd:1

value
8327865900
script pubkey
OP_0 OP_PUSHBYTES_20 420c82d42d9c6861aa2ed8c9d028620126e9ca89
address
bc1qggxg94pdn35xr23wmryaq2rzqynwnj5frxwssl
transaction
23b0d58c45ee88d543b4e0f5e8148eb27b5961a4c3a1bdb3f1db90ec06eee8bd